These cars weren't designed for living life a quarter mile at a time...what you pay for is a car that is a total beast on a road course, which is something you car would probably never be able to do. Carbon ceramic brakes, a very good vehicle stability control system, etc...it not only goes fast, it can actually sustain that type of driving for hours on end. People can be faster in a quarter mile because they only have to accelerate and brake once...keep doing it over and over again, and that's where you'll find the need for reliability that drives the price up.

While it may not be worth the price of admission to you, I personally feel that you can't get a car that can do what it can, WITH a warranty, for that kind of money. Maybe I'm biased because I've personally been spanked by one on a 2.2 mile road course.

The issue is that most people mod their cars on this site for 1/4 times and only see every performance car in one and same dimension.

That said , the zr1 and GT-R are the only two "super cars" in the $100k range that are in same performance category that Europe has to offer.

It may not be in reach financially for lot of people on this site, including myself but a 100k car that can outdo the competition (which is priced atleast 3x much) is simply amazing! There's a reason why Engineers that create these cars go home with well over $140k a year.

Sure I can put a foxbody Gutted,caged,slicks with a forged 402 on laughing gas that runs high 8s under $25k.
The difference is the fox 'd have no MPGs, warranty, modern amenities, or know what to do with itself around a 60 degree curve.
